Cheryl has been instrumental in driving volunteer engagement and championing the important work that volunteers perform on the Sunshine Coast.
Cheryl is the current chair/president of Healthy Ageing Partnerships, which aims to empower older Australians to make informed decisions about their health through knowledge sharing.
Cheryl’s contribution to community service and dedication to helping others in a manner that is compassionate, informed and caring was recognised in her being awarded QLD Senior Australian of the Year.
